Wow! eGrabber has a patent on how to find emails on the internet

A VERY big shout of congratulations goes out to Chandra Bodapati (et al) for receiving a patent on "methods and systems for determining email addresses." How cool is that?! I hope, hope, hope to interview him online about this soon. (fingers crossed)

In the meantime, I can only speculate what this means to all of the other recruiting tools on the market today. Will they have to pay Chandra a royalty if their tools work the way eGrabber products do? Will this slow down (or stop altogether) competing products from entering the market or, will they simply come up with new ways that do not infringe upon Chandra's patent? For that matter, will it just be that competing products will do everything else but find free emails when sourcing leads?

Here are some relevant notes...

I believe a recruiter does not need an high IQ to find email Address of a candidate or a prospect.
They just need the ability to remember couple of dozen techniques & Scripts

"experts" tend to find email ID faster because, they know which of the techniques to use first.

Freshers usually try a few  of the scripts in  random and  give up because it is very time-consuming to get results,

At eGrabber, we included many of scripts that several top sourcers use into one product called "Account Researcher".

When a beginning or expert sourcer enters name/company - Our Product-expert runs through all the scripts sequenced in an expert format  - many running in parallel - to get you the email ID if it exists. If their email is not available, it will try to find email of colleagues closest to where your prospect and projects a statistically most accurate email-ID for the person.
